Great to meet you!

At times, life can be increasingly difficult to manage and our “go to” ways for handling stress become less effective. As a result, we may begin to experience difficulty with focus, decreased motivation, irritability/anger, or even periods of low mood or high anxiety. If ignored, these symptoms can negatively impact performance at work, in the classroom, across our interpersonal relationships, or even on the sports field. My collaborative approach allows for me to come alongside my clients and begin working through some of life's challenges from day one.

A bit about my approach to therapy

I utilize a solution-focused and mindfulness approach within a cognitive behavioral model of therapy. In addition, I have extensive experience in supporting individuals and couples with past history of trauma through the use of Cognitive Processing Therapy, Prolonged Exposure Therapy, and Cognitive Behavioral Conjoint Therapy for PTSD.

What you can expect from our first session

My client population has ranged from adolescent years through late-adulthood. In addition, I have a unique background of working with military personnel and first-responders. I look forward to the opportunity to collaborate with you to achieve your desired goals.

Initial sessions will focus on building rapport and establishing trust as we conduct assessments, establish goals, and begin our work together!
